How do Eric Emanuel pants fit and what sizing should you pick?

Go true to size for the intended relaxed-but-clean look; size higher only if you want extra drape and stacking, or down for a higher ankle and slimmer leg. The elastic waistband plus drawstring cover small waist differences, while elastic cuffs keep the opening from dragging even if you size up.

EE sweatpants utilize heavyweight fleece that maintains structure but breaks in after a few wears, which means the thigh will feel roomier on day one and conform naturally over time. Track pants are lighter with more flow, so the leg falls straighter and stacks a bit more on the shoe, eric emanuel shorts blue while the taper still keeps the silhouette sharp. If you’re between sizes, base your choice on how you want the cuff to land: sizing up increases stacking and a looser top block; sizing down raises the hem while reduces billow without turning the leg skinny. For broader builds, true to length usually avoids tightness at the thigh due to the elastic waistband; for slimmer builds, standard size prevents an overly skinny ankle because the cuff gathers naturally. Fleece can experience slight tightening after the first wash if heat-dried; wash cold and air-dry or tumble low to preserve your true fit.

Release Rhythm plus How to Cop Before Sellout

Most releases are timed drops announced just beforehand, often landing on Friday around noon Eastern on the official site, with occasional pop-ups or boutique partners. Pairs can move in minutes, so preparation—accounts, payment methods, and sizing decisions set—is the difference between checkout and «sold out.»

Track Eric Emanuel’s official channels for release dates and line sheets; announcements typically surface via social posts, email, and SMS. Being signed in early, using a saved checkout method like Google Pay or Shop Pay, and reloading item pages at launch hour minimizes friction at the cart. Sizes that sit in the common sweet spot tend to disappear first, but restocks happen unpredictably, so keep the page open for a few minutes after sellout. If you miss, trusted marketplaces list new pairs fast; weigh platform fees and delivery time against need and your size availability. For in-person activations, expect queue systems and wristbands; bring photo ID and be ready with a secondary size since floor inventory can vary from the online matrix.

Fabric, Maintenance, plus Seasonality That Affect Fit and Price

Fabric weight plus seasonality change both hang and cost: heavyweight fleece drapes structured and warm, whereas athletic fabrics drape lighter and breathe better, with trims upping complexity plus price. Limited seasonal palettes plus co-branded graphics add desirability which pushes demand.

Care practices can shift the fit across time. Fleece prefers cool wash, reversed, low or air dry to preserve shape and prevent unnecessary tightening; heat accelerates pilling plus can shorten the effective inseam by nudging the hem band. Track pants handle machine wash cold well and usually maintain length and color vibrancy if you skip harsh soaps plus high heat. Because the taper and cuffs are integral to the silhouette, preserving the waist elasticity and cuff bounce maintains the intended fit intact weeks into wear. Seasonal collections launch alongside climate shifts—cotton-heavy assortments during cooler months and thinner track builds as temps rise—which quietly cues which fabrics will remain in circulation and what resale pricing might behave. If you intend to rotate pairs across seasons, treat fleece as your winter anchor and track as the warm-weather go-to; this approach reflects the way the brand sequences its drops and helps you prioritize which releases to chase at retail versus wait for on resale.
